Producer: Chateau de la Font du Loup

Vintage: 1996

Size: 750ml

ABV: 14.3%

Varietal: Southern Rhone Red Blend

    Country/Region: France, Rhone

      Chteau de la Font du Loup`s flagship cuve, a representation of the estate`s excellence, combines black fruits, spices, and a sophisticated floral character. Its palate unfolds with hints of cherry eau-de-vie, liquorice, and black pepper.

                                                        Producer Information

                                                        Chateau Font du Loup can be translated into Fountain of the Wolf. The name according to the Southern Rhone Valley local folk lore dates back to a time when wolves drank from the various springs located on the property. Its also the name of lieu-dit, where many of their vines are planted. Font du Loup Chateau Font du Loup came into being when it was purchased by the Charles Melia family in 1942. However, it took until 1979 before the first estate bottled wines were produced and sold. Prior to that time, their harvest was sold to negociants. Today, the Chateau Font de Loup estate is managed by Anne-Charlotte Melia and her husband Laurent Bachas. Chateau Font du Loup owns 19.5 hectares of vines in Chateauneuf du Pape. This includes 4 hectares of old vine Grenache that were purchased in 1992. Much of their terroir is located on cooler, sandy soils that is often effected by the famed mistral winds that hit the region. One hectare is devoted to the production of white wine, while the remaining 18.5 hectares are used for planting grapes suited for their red Chateauneuf du Pape wine. The vineyards are 100% organically farmed. Philippe Cambie is the consultant.
